How to Remove Coffee Stains From Carpets and Fabric

Americans often clean coffee spots and spills on carpet and fabric that tend to leave a stain. Coffee stains are removable, but fast action and the correct cleaning products make the job easier and success more likely. Does this Spark an idea?
Instructions

1
React immediately to a coffee spill on carpet or fabric by blotting with a towel to absorb the liquid. This is especially important on carpet to keep the liquid off the padding and the backing.

2
Determine whether the coffee contains cream or milk. Milk and cream will require a two-part removal process. If there is milk or cream in the coffee, use an enzyme laundry detergent or carpet shampoo first. Mix this product according to the instructions or put 1 tsp. laundry detergent into 1 cup of water, according to the Michigan State University Extension Service. Blot the stain with a washcloth soaked in the mixture. Skip this step if the coffee has no cream.

3
Mix 1/2 cup of white vinegar with 1/2 cup of water, recommends the University of Nebraska at Lincoln website. Blot the area with this weak acid mixture to remove the coffee stain.

4
Follow any stain removal with clear warm water sponging of the entire area, suggests the University of Illinois Extension Service.

5
Place a dry towel and a book on the treated spot, and allow it to dry for a day or so. The University of Illinois recommends a pad of towels and a brick for drying. When the carpet is dry, vacuum to fluff the carpet's pile.

Tips & Warnings
Coffee is a tannin product. Do not use any soap products on tannins, as it may make the stain more difficult to remove.
